How much do embroidery production man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average yearly pay for embroidery production manager in Indiana is $67,440.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,300.00 and $76,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Embroidery Production Manager do?

An Embroidery Production Manager oversees the entire embroidery production process, ensuring high-quality output, efficient workflow, and timely order completion. They manage production schedules, supervise staff, maintain equipment, and enforce quality control standards. Additionally, they coordinate with designers, vendors, and clients to ensure designs meet specifications. Strong leadership, organization, and problem-solving skills are essential for success in this role.

What are typical challenges faced by an Embroidery Production Manager, and how does the role address them?

One of the main challenges for an Embroidery Production Manager is balancing high production efficiency with strict quality standards, especially during tight deadlines. The role often involves troubleshooting machine issues, managing varying order sizes, and accommodating custom client requests, all while optimizing workflow and minimizing downtime. Successful managers address these challenges by maintaining proactive communication with their teams, implementing continuous process improvements, and staying adaptable when priorities shift. This dynamic work environment provides opportunities to develop strong problem-solving skills and can pave the way for advancement into senior operations or plant management ro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Embroidery Production Manager position, and why are they important?

An Embroidery Production Manager requires expertise in textile production processes, quality control, and team management, usually supported by experience in garment manufacturing or a related field. Familiarity with embroidery machines (both manual and automated), production scheduling software, and inventory management systems is highly valuable, and certifications in textile or apparel management can be a plus. Excellent organ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ication abilities help individuals excel in leading production teams and coordinating projects. These combined skills are essential for ensuring efficient, high-quality output and meeting production deadlines within a fast-paced manufacturing environment.

General Position Summary
The Product Owner - Manager is a key leadership role responsible for guiding a Scrum Team, some of whom are direct reports, in delivering maximum value to business stakeholders. This position operates within an Agile practice, leveraging SCRUM to align business goals with technology solutions and ensure successful product delivery.
Principal Duties and Responsibilities
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for business stakeholders, ensuring that their needs and priorities are understood, communicated, and reflected in product development initiatives.
  • Own product backlog and quarterly plan based on close collaboration with business partners.
  • Effectively communicate to and lead a broad range of people at multiple levels within the organization.
  • Works closely with other Product Owners to ensure product dependencies are synchronized.
  • Partner with Scrum Master to lead, mentor, and develop a Scrum Team, fostering a collaborative and high-performance environment. Provide coaching and support to ensure team members understand their roles and responsibilities within the Agile process.
  • Drive the team's focus on delivering incremental value through iterative development and regular feedback cycles. Champion a customer-centric approach to prioritize features and enhancements that align with business objectives.
  • Promote and implement Agile best practices, including backlog refinement, sprint planning, and review ceremonies. Ensure adherence to the principles and processes of the Scaled Agile Framework.
  • A critical Change Agent driving organizational change management, standardizing tools and applications and enforcing new processes.
  • An innovator and an influencer.

Job Required Knowledge and Skills
  • Bachelor's degree in business, Computer Science, or related field.
  • Proven experience as a Product Owner, Product Manager, or similar role in an Agile environment.
  • Extensive experience and knowledge of the following areas with Microsoft D365: Finance, Supply Chain Management, Distribution, Warehousing, Inventory Management, Retail Sales, and Merchandising.
  • Strong experience with Azure DevOps.
  • Experience writing epics, features, user stories, and acceptance criteria.
  • Track record of driving Quarterly Planning, setting priority, helping drive business value and IT complexity.
  • Advanced skills and knowledge of servant leadership, facilitation, situational awareness, conflict resolution, continual improvement, empowerment, and increasing transparency.
  • Ability to anticipate issues based on experience to help the team avoid or resolve the issues.
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ills including active listening and the ability to influence or persuade others in positive or negative circumstances.
  • Knowledge of common business applications and collaboration tools.
  • Experience leading teams, with direct reports, in a scaled Agile framework.
  • Strong understanding of Agile methodologies, principles, and tools.
  • Excellent communication, problem solving, leadership, and stakeholder management skills.
  • Ability to inspire, motivate, and develop high-performing teams.
  • Analytical mindset with a focus on delivering measurable business outcomes, critical thinker and problem solver.
